                                             Boolean Searching

Boolean searching is used to search the online catalog using the Keyword Boolean search.  In the Keyword Boolean search you will be using connectors to connect keywords.  These connectors are AND, OR, and NOT

Connector   Purpose Example
And Focus or narrow a search medications and handbook

            

This connector will find all documents that contain both the keywords in the example..

 

Connector   Purpose Example
Or Expand or broaden a search medications or handbook

 

This connector will find either keyword in any document.  The record in the online catalog may contain one or both of the keywords.

 

Connector Purpose Example
Not  Exclude specific terms medications not handbook

 

The connector will find documents in the online catalog that contain only the keyword medication but does not contain handbook.
